Output e753bba0cf98840f12000076ccb95f1a89f0f3bd071485ea062862e9a9b0cf7f:1

value
1163151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bc0a88afc89f8ba795c92290abe21d0ee1db4b OP_EQUAL
address
3FhtaDpW4hBcxTofaKLioTZi1EdcCzuejz
transaction
e753bba0cf98840f12000076ccb95f1a89f0f3bd071485ea062862e9a9b0cf7f
spent
true